Enthusiasm

 What is it that fills you with enthusiasm, that energizes you and lead to great accomplishment and fulfillment in your life? Christians ought to be the most enthusiastic of all people. The word enthusiasm originates from the word en + theos (God) and denotes a belief in special revelations of the Holy Spirit, strong excitement of feeling, and something inspiring zeal or fervour. 

God is the source of our enthusiasm - how can we not be enthusiastic? He is enthusiastic about you - therefore you should be enthusiastic about Him and what He has planted in your heart. Paul was a man of enthusiasm - he was so enthusiastic about the Gospel that some  people in Corinth accused him of madness ( 2 Cor 5:13).

Enthusiasm is like steam that pressurizes, empowers and impels action. If you are not enthusiastic about something in your life, you are in danger of becoming idle, negative and worrisome. Some people just oozes enthusiasm and it attracts people, resources, happiness and fulfillment, because they sow the wind and therefore they reap the whirlwind ( Gal 6:7).

Enthusiasm can be developed and cultivated. It is possible to be enthusiastic anywhere and in any circumstance because Godly enthusiasm will deliver you from self-pity and worry, because it will focus you on the source of enthusiasm, God Himself! (Heb 12:1-2)
